  11. I have a software that can read the rupee history (even when it is in use) and store the transactions in a MySQL database. It wouldn't be too hard to make a service where EMC members could make it read their rupee history and show various statistics, but the problem is that it needs members' EMC password in order to get the data.

    I'm not sure how many or if any members would change and/or use their EMC password (which, BTW, can and perhaps should be different from the Minecraft password) with a 3rd party software.
